Lisa Van Quickelberghe (born 1987 in Zottegem) is an Antwerp-based artist whose work is deeply personal and intuitive. She endeavors to encapsulate the high intensity of emotions experienced in her personal relationships through a visual language. The figures she depicts are usually individuals from her close circle. Her inspiration is drawn from a wide array of sources: found objects, newspaper clippings, the animal kingdom, abandoned books, memories, and so on. She is predominantly guided by intuition and the emotions present at the moment. Only in retrospect does the final image reveal its meaning. It seems as though the image seeks to convey something to her, rather than the other way around. For Lisa, creating is a means to decipher her own inner world.
